Own board bring-up, hardware-software integration, and system validation of embedded computing platforms.
Deliver technical feasibility analysis, develop proof-of-concepts, and conduct system demonstrations for customers and OEM partners.
Provide end-to-end technical support including operating system configuration, debugging, testing, and documentation across the product lifecycle.
0-1 years work experience in embedded computing platform development and integration.
Bachelor's degree in Electronics, ECE, Embedded Systems or related field (BTech/B.E).
Experience with embedded platforms (Intel, ARM, NVIDIA, PowerPC), OS (Embedded Linux, Windows), and interfaces (PCIe, Ethernet, USB, SATA, Serial, VPX, VME, CompactPCI).
Proficiency in C/C++ programming, BSP configuration, driver integration, and embedded application development.
Comfortable working on multi-architecture embedded systems with hardware-software co-design and low-level debugging.
Able to independently handle system integration, interface validation, and prepare technical documentation for diverse audiences.
Experienced in collaborating across teams and directly engaging with customers for technical support and solution delivery.
